    3 Ingredient Pumpkin Spice Muffins

    Recipe by: Kristin Hayes
    Quick, easy 3 Ingredient Pumpkin Spice Muffins
    4.50 from 6 votes
    Prevent your screen from going dark
    Print Recipe Pin Recipe Rate this Recipe
    Prep Time 15 minutes mins
    Cook Time 20 minutes mins
    Course Breakfast, Snack
    Cuisine American
    Servings 12 Muffins
    Calories 287 kcal

    Equipment

    • muffin tray
    • Mixing Bowls
    • Muffin Liners

    Ingredients
      

    • 1 Box Spice Cake Mix
    • 15 oz canned pumpkin
    • 1 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ips

    Instructions
     

    • Preheat oven to 350 F
    • In a medium bowl, combine spice cake mix and pumpkin puree
    • Once mixed, fold in chocolate chips
    • Line a muffin pan with liners, or spray with non-stick cooking spray
    • Fill each muffin cup ⅔ full with batter
    • Place in oven, bake for 16-18 minutes or until toothpick comes out clean
    • Remove from oven and allow muffins to set for 5 minutes. Enjoy!
